1、下载安装docker
我使用yum安装的docker,如果您不确定是否安装yum
请执行:
代码语言:javascript复制-- 下载yum压缩包
wget http://yum.baseurl.org/download/3.2/yum-3.2.28.tar.gz
-- 解压
tar xvf yum-3.2.28.tar.gz
--安装
cd yum-3.2.28
sudo apt install yum
--更新
yum check-update
yum update
yum clean all
或者使用: centos7安装yum_tt_best的博客-CSDN博客_centos7安装yum
安装完成yum后,使用yum安装docker
[root@localhost ~]# yum -y install docker
2、启动docker
[root@localhost ~]# service docker start
3、检查docker是否安装成功
[root@localhost ~]# docker version Client: Version: 1.13.1
看到版本信息说明安装成功!
4、修改镜像源
docker安装完成后默认会在/etc/docker目录下生成配置文件,进入对应目录
修改docker的镜像源实则是修改daemon.json文件,如果您进入目录后没有对应的daemon文件,请自行新建,如果路径下有daemon.json文件,则直接编辑即可。
代码语言:javascript复制touch daemon.json
chmod 775 daemon.json
vim daemon.json
复制如下内容:
{
"registry-mirrors": ["http://hub-mirror.c.163.com"]
#也可以使用下方其他镜像源
}
粘贴后,esc,:wq保存退出
Docker中国区官方镜像 https://registry.docker-cn.com 网易 http://hub-mirror.c.163.com ustc https://docker.mirrors.ustc.edu.cn 中国科技大学 https://docker.mirrors.ustc.edu.cn
docker镜像源
5、重启docker
[root@localhost ~] linux Centos 7命令 systemctl restart docker docker重启后,docker中的服务并不会自动重启,所以需要自己手动使用docker start xxxx手动重启
2、安装nacos镜像
[root@localhost ~]# docker pull nacos/nacos-server:1.0.0
这边没有安装最新版,而是指定了版本号。如需要安装最新版,执行以下命令查询nacos版本列表,根据列表可选择自己需要的版本进行下载
[root@localhost ~]# docker pull nacos/nacos-server
3、查看nacos镜像
[root@localhost ~]# docker images
4、启动nacos镜像
记得使用firewall-cmd --list-port 查看一下linux有没有开放nacos的8848端口
当前我的是开放了8848端口,如果小伙伴没有开放呢,可以使用开启,–permanent表示永久有效,如果不加当前命令,表示重启后就不生效了。
代码语言:javascript复制firewall-cmd --zone=public --add-port=8848/tcp --permanent
开放后记得重启防火墙
代码语言:javascript复制firewall-cmd --reload
[root@localhost ~]# docker run --env MODE=standalone --name nacos -d -p 8848:8848 nacos/nacos-server:1.0.0
这边做了端口映射,最后可以通过 ip:8848/nacos 访问,登录密码默认nacos/nacos
注册成功~